Fans got to hear more Taylor Swiftthe new song from in the second trailer of the film Where the Crawdads sing, based on the best-selling book of the same name. The Grammy winner wrote and recorded the song “Carolina” for the film.

The new trailer also shows fans a bit more about what to expect from the film – and more about star character Kya. The film tells the story of Kya, who grows up alone in the North Carolina swamps and later becomes entangled in a murder mystery.

The singer first teased “Carolina” in the film’s first trailer, which premiered in March. Now we have a bit more information about the dark and spooky song – including new lyrics.

“You didn’t see me here / No, they never saw me here,” Taylor sings ominously between clips of the star Daisy EdgarJones, who plays Kya, trying to make a living on her own before prosecutors, who charge her with murder, seek the death penalty for her. “In the mist, in the clouds/No, you didn’t see me here/I’ll ​​clench my fist, I’ll make it count/There are places I’ll never go/Things that only Carolina will know never.”

Where the Crawdads Sing arrives exclusively in theaters on July 15.
